It serves as the entry point to the nation\u2019s top services, including the Indian Administrative Service (IAS), Indian Foreign Service (IFS), Indian Police Service (IPS), and many others. For aspirants beginning this journey, understanding the UPSC Exam Pattern 2026 is the first and most important step. The exam is conducted in three stages: Prelims Examination, Mains Examination, and the Personality Test (Interview). The Prelims serve as a filtering mechanism, allowing a limited number of candidates to progress to the Mains Examination.<\/p>\r\n<table>\r\n<tbody>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td class=\"tb-color\" colspan=\"5\"><strong>UPSC Prelims Exam Pattern 2026<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><strong>Papers<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>Subjects<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>No. of questions<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>Total Marks<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>Duration<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><strong>Paper 1<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td>General Studies (GS)<\/td>\r\n<td>100<\/td>\r\n<td>200<\/td>\r\n<td>2 hours<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td><strong>Paper 2<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td>CSAT<\/td>\r\n<td>80<\/td>\r\n<td>200<\/td>\r\n<td>2 hours<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td colspan=\"2\"><strong>Total<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>180<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>400<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td><strong>4 hours<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<\/tbody>\r\n<\/table>\r\n<h2>UPSC Exam Pattern for Mains 2026<\/h2>\r\n<p>The UPSC Mains paper pattern is the core evaluation phase, comprising a mix of compulsory and optional papers. It includes language papers, essay writing, general studies papers, and optional subject papers. This stage delves deep into a candidate's understanding of subjects, their ability to articulate ideas, and their analytical prowess.<\/p>\r\n<p>The <strong>written examination consists of 9 papers<\/strong> out of which 2 papers are qualifying in nature. The marks obtained in the remaining 7 papers and the interview test together are considered for making the final merit.<\/p>\r\n<figure class=\"table\">\r\n<table>\r\n<tbody>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td class=\"tb-color\"><strong>Paper Name<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td class=\"tb-color\"><strong>Time Duration<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td class=\"tb-color\"><strong>Total Marks<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<td class=\"tb-color\"><strong>Nature of Paper<\/strong><\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per A \u2013 Compulsory Indian Language Paper<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>300<\/td>\r\n<td rowspan=\"2\">Qualifying in nature<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per B \u2013 English Language Paper<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>300<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per I \u2013 Essay<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<td rowspan=\"7\">Considered for Merit<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per II \u2013 General Studies I<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per III \u2013 General Studies II<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per IV \u2013 General Studies III<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per V \u2013 General Studies IV<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per VI \u2013 Optional Paper I<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Paper VII \u2013 Optional Paper II<\/td>\r\n<td>3 hours<\/td>\r\n<td>250<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Total<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<td>1750<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Interview\/ Personality Test<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<td>275<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<tr>\r\n<td>Grand Total<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<td>2025<\/td>\r\n<td>-<\/td>\r\n<\/tr>\r\n<\/tbody>\r\n<\/table>\r\n<\/figure>\r\n<h2>UPSC Exam Pattern 2026 for Interview Round<\/h2>\r\n<p>The final stage, the <a href=\"https:\/\/vajiramandravi.com\/upsc-exam\/upsc-interview\/\" target=\"_blank\">UPSC Interview<\/a> or Personality Test, is where aspirants' personalities are evaluated. A panel of experts assesses qualities such as mental alertness, clear and logical exposition, critical powers of assimilation, balance of judgement, ability for social cohesion and leadership, and intellectual and moral integrity. The number of candidates selected for the Interview will be around twice the number of vacancies to be filled. This stage aims to determine the candidate's suitability for the dynamic and diverse responsibilities of civil services. It is important to note by the aspirants that there is no negative marking in the <a href=\"https:\/\/vajiramandravi.com\/upsc-exam\/upsc-mains\/\" target=\"_blank\">UPSC Mains<\/a> exam as it is a subjective paper, and the assessment is based on the quality of your descriptive answers.<\/p>\r\n<h3>Negative Marking in UPSC Prelims<\/h3>\r\n<p>In the UPSC Prelims exam pattern, there are two papers - GS paper 1 and CSAT. Each paper consists of objective-type questions. The negative marking pattern for both papers is as follows:<\/p>\r\n<ul>\r\n\t<li>For each incorrect answer, there is a penalty of 1\/3rd of the assigned marks to that question.<\/li>\r\n\t<li>If a candidate provides multiple answers to a single question, even if one of the given answers is correct, it will still be considered an incorrect response. In such cases, the same penalty as mentioned above will apply to that particular question.<\/li>\r\n\t<li>Unattempted questions do not have any penalty.<\/li>\r\n<\/ul>\r\n<figure
